Guaranty Bonds Are Insurance Policies



Surety bonds aren't insurance coverage. This is a common mistaken belief that lots of people have. It is very important to comprehend the difference between the two.

Insurance coverage are developed to safeguard the insured celebration from potential future losses. They provide insurance coverage for a variety of threats, including residential property damages, obligation, and personal injury.

On the other hand, guaranty bonds are a type of warranty that guarantees a specific commitment will be fulfilled. They're typically utilized in building and construction jobs to ensure that service providers finish their job as agreed upon. The surety bond gives financial security to the project owner in case the professional fails to meet their responsibilities.

Guaranty Bonds Are Just for Building Tasks



Currently let's move our emphasis to the misunderstanding that surety bonds are solely made use of in construction jobs. While it holds true that guaranty bonds are commonly associated with the building industry, they aren't limited to it.

Guaranty bonds are in fact used in various markets and industries to make sure that contractual responsibilities are satisfied. For example, they're used in the transportation market for products brokers and carriers, in the production industry for distributors and representatives, and in the service market for specialists such as plumbers and electrical experts.

Surety bonds offer economic protection and assurance that forecasts or solutions will be completed as agreed upon. So, it is necessary to keep in mind that surety bonds aren't special to building and construction jobs, but rather function as a valuable tool in several sectors.
